About BOILED PEANUTS, SALT 'N VINEGAR
BOILED PEANUTS, SALT 'N VINEGAR is a calorie-dense food with 250 calories per 100-gram serving. Its primary macronutrient source is fat, providing 13.9g of protein, 19.4g of carbohydrates, and 12.5g of fat. It also contributes 8.3g of dietary fiber per serving. This food belongs to the Canned Vegetables category.
Ingredients
BOILED PEANUTS, WATER, SALT, SODIUM DIACETATE, ERYTHORBIC ACID.
